Subject: Re: [PATCH v14 3/6] KVM: s390: pv: add KVM_CAP_S390_PROTECTED_ASYNC_DISABLE
Date: Mon, 10 Oct 2022 15:10:34 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<0059c67b-3dda-e95d-9b96-8c69af77bbb9@linux.ibm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20221010141511.25eca963@p-imbrenda>

On 10/10/22 14:15, Claudio Imbrenda wrote:
> On Mon, 10 Oct 2022 13:45:54 +0200
> Janosch Frank <frankja@linux.ibm.com> wrote:
> 
>> On 9/30/22 16:01, Claudio Imbrenda wrote:
>>> Add KVM_CAP_S390_PROTECTED_ASYNC_DISABLE to signal that the
>>> KVM_PV_ASYNC_DISABLE and KVM_PV_ASYNC_DISABLE_PREPARE commands for the
>>> KVM_S390_PV_COMMAND ioctl are available.
>>>
>>> Signed-off-by: Claudio Imbrenda <imbrenda@linux.ibm.com>
>>> Reviewed-by: Nico Boehr <nrb@linux.ibm.com>
>>> ---
>>>    ar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c | 3 +++
>>>    include/uapi/linux/kvm.h | 1 +
>>>    2 files changed, 4 insertions(+)
>>>
>>> diff --git a/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c b/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c
>>> index d0027964a6f5..7a3bd68efd85 100644
>>> --- a/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c
>>> +++ b/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c
>>> @@ -618,6 +618,9 @@ int kvm_vm_ioctl_check_extension(struct kvm *kvm, long ext)
>>>    	case KVM_CAP_S390_BPB:
>>>    		r = test_facility(82);
>>>    		break;
>>> +	case KVM_CAP_S390_PROTECTED_ASYNC_DISABLE:
>>> +		r = async_destroy && is_prot_virt_host();
>>> +		break;
>>>    	case KVM_CAP_S390_PROTECTED:
>>>    		r = is_prot_virt_host();
>>>    		break;
>>> diff --git a/include/uapi/linux/kvm.h b/include/uapi/linux/kvm.h
>>> index 02602c5c1975..9afe0084b2c5 100644
>>> --- a/include/uapi/linux/kvm.h
>>> +++ b/include/uapi/linux/kvm.h
>>> @@ -1177,6 +1177,7 @@ struct kvm_ppc_resize_hpt {
>>>    #define KVM_CAP_VM_DISABLE_NX_HUGE_PAGES 220
>>>    #define KVM_CAP_S390_ZPCI_OP 221
>>>    #define KVM_CAP_S390_CPU_TOPOLOGY 222
>>> +#define KVM_CAP_S390_PROTECTED_ASYNC_DISABLE 225
>>
>> I can see 223 in Paolo's next, is there a 224 that I've missed?
> 
> no, I set this to an arbitrarily high value to avoid conficts
> 
> seems like I got it more or less right :)
> 
> feel free to change the value of the macro when merging, so it's
> contiguous.

Reviewed-by: Janosch Frank <frankja@linux.ibm.com>
